Output e850c9fccbd0fe0a1e210dd9768296c23646496273aee1f3521f7ca921c79a35:6

value
3442000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f18aefb16127d19eaa7092e14dc146ffb19210 OP_EQUAL
address
37FFpje65UrdaVkbZpAF29QSK9C8gowgqJ
transaction
e850c9fccbd0fe0a1e210dd9768296c23646496273aee1f3521f7ca921c79a35
spent
true